MacDill hosts AIM event with 85th FTS

T-6A Texan II aircraft assigned to the 85th Flying Training Squadron are shown on the flight line at MacDill Air Force Base, Florida, Oct. 15, 2022. The T-6A is used to train Joint Primary Pilot Training students in fundamental flying skills needed to become U.S. Air Force and Navy pilots. Instructor pilots assigned to the 85th FTS participated in an Aviation Inspiration Mentorship event at MacDill where they shared their experiences in the military with future aviators.
